Up until recently I just washed every day with Dove soap.  But this winter has been particularly harsh and so I have actually had to start moisturizing.  I have had a difficult time finding just the right moisturizer.  I have really sensitive skin and I am allergic to chamomile (I have hayfever), so I have to be careful with what I put on my skin.  I have about 20 jars and bottles of various creams that are in my bathroom vanity that I have tried.  Either they are too heavy and cause me to break out, they have overpowering smells, or they give me hives.  I guess that is why I stuck with Dove.

Recently I was sent a sample face masque from Montagne Jeunesse Clay Spa in my Influenster Maple Vox Box for me to try.  I was prepared not to like it or have some sort of allergy reaction.  What I wasn't prepared for was how amazing the Clay Infused Fabric Masque was.  I have done clay masks before, but they were all so terribly drying.  With the old clay masks it made my skin feel like a mask...so much that I was worried that my face would crack.

This was absolutely not the case with the Montagne Jeunesse Masque.  I made a short video of when I used the Masque for the first time.  I walk you through the steps of using the Masque and then at the end I give my honest reaction to the results.  Yes, it looks scary, but it is well worth it.
